出版時(shí)間:2010-3 出版社:機(jī)械工業(yè)出版社 作者:杜曉通 頁(yè)數(shù):262
前言
無(wú)線傳感器網(wǎng)絡(luò)(Wireless Sensor Network,WSN)是繼互聯(lián)網(wǎng)之后,又一重大的影響人類(lèi)生活方式的熱點(diǎn)技術(shù)。它的出現(xiàn)將改變?nèi)伺c自然交互的方式,使信息世界與真實(shí)物理世界更緊密地融合在一起?! ∮捎跓o(wú)線傳感器網(wǎng)絡(luò)具備的巨大潛力,吸引了眾多研究者從事無(wú)線傳感器網(wǎng)絡(luò)技術(shù)研究與開(kāi)發(fā)工作。在無(wú)線傳感器網(wǎng)絡(luò)技術(shù)出現(xiàn)之前,人們已經(jīng)對(duì)不同類(lèi)型的有線、無(wú)線網(wǎng)絡(luò)進(jìn)行了深入的研究,但由于無(wú)線傳感器網(wǎng)絡(luò)低功耗、低成本、自組織、自適應(yīng)、無(wú)人職守等特點(diǎn),導(dǎo)致無(wú)線傳感器網(wǎng)絡(luò)與當(dāng)前成熟的有線、無(wú)線網(wǎng)絡(luò)相比無(wú)論是在通信協(xié)議還是工程應(yīng)用方面都有很大的不同。為了使無(wú)線傳感器網(wǎng)絡(luò)真正為人類(lèi)服務(wù),必須進(jìn)行工業(yè)化的節(jié)點(diǎn)生產(chǎn)和大規(guī)模的工程應(yīng)用,這需要更多的人掌握無(wú)線傳感器網(wǎng)絡(luò)技術(shù),才能把對(duì)無(wú)線傳感器網(wǎng)絡(luò)的憧憬變?yōu)楝F(xiàn)實(shí)?! o(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)是構(gòu)成無(wú)線傳感器網(wǎng)絡(luò)的基礎(chǔ),無(wú)線傳感器網(wǎng)絡(luò)的所有工作都是由節(jié)點(diǎn)完成的。節(jié)點(diǎn)雖小,但需要掌握的知識(shí)卻非常廣。既有中、低頻的傳統(tǒng)嵌入式設(shè)計(jì),又有高頻的射頻電路;既要有一般的數(shù)據(jù)采集與控制軟件,又要有自組網(wǎng)、路由、標(biāo)準(zhǔn)鏈路等復(fù)雜的軟件設(shè)計(jì)。由于學(xué)校專(zhuān)業(yè)設(shè)置問(wèn)題,幾乎沒(méi)有一個(gè)專(zhuān)業(yè)能夠覆蓋無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)所涉及的技術(shù),因此對(duì)于希望自行開(kāi)發(fā)無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)、針對(duì)特定工程應(yīng)用進(jìn)行開(kāi)發(fā)的讀者來(lái)講,利用無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)通用設(shè)計(jì)技術(shù),充分發(fā)揮自身的技術(shù)優(yōu)勢(shì),以獲得更有效的2T_程應(yīng)用是其非常盼望的事情。 本書(shū)立足工程應(yīng)用,在強(qiáng)調(diào)無(wú)線傳感器網(wǎng)絡(luò)理論的同時(shí),更多地突出了無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用和開(kāi)發(fā),特別是無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)的軟硬件的開(kāi)發(fā),在介紹通用軟硬件設(shè)計(jì)的前提下,針對(duì)不同應(yīng)用給出了精簡(jiǎn)的設(shè)計(jì)思想?! ∽髡咴趯?shí)際工作中發(fā)現(xiàn)操作系統(tǒng)對(duì)無(wú)線傳感器網(wǎng)絡(luò)技術(shù)成熟可靠的應(yīng)用非常重要。通過(guò)操作系統(tǒng)可以將開(kāi)發(fā)成熟的軟件變?yōu)楣碳?,?dāng)新功能開(kāi)發(fā)出來(lái)后,通過(guò)添加任務(wù)的方式擴(kuò)展固件,對(duì)原有的固件幾乎不需要更改,這樣就使合作開(kāi)發(fā)成為可能,大大降低了無(wú)線傳感器網(wǎng)絡(luò)系統(tǒng)的開(kāi)發(fā)難度,也極大方便了無(wú)線傳感器網(wǎng)絡(luò)功能的升級(jí)和完善。本書(shū)在附錄中給出了作者自行開(kāi)發(fā)的微代碼的操作系統(tǒng)——PICl8系列微處理器網(wǎng)絡(luò)版操作系統(tǒng),希望能給讀者提供些幫助?! ∪珪?shū)共分10章。第1章介紹無(wú)線傳感器網(wǎng)絡(luò)的發(fā)展歷史和相關(guān)的基本概念。第2章介紹了IEEE 802.15.4協(xié)議的內(nèi)容。第3章介紹了zigBee協(xié)議的內(nèi)容。
內(nèi)容概要
本書(shū)比較全面地論述了無(wú)線傳感器網(wǎng)絡(luò)所涉及的關(guān)鍵技術(shù),包括無(wú)線傳感器網(wǎng)絡(luò)的概念、特點(diǎn)和節(jié)點(diǎn)的開(kāi)發(fā)等。全書(shū)共分為10章,內(nèi)容包括無(wú)線傳感器的概念、通信協(xié)議、定位與信息處理、開(kāi)發(fā)無(wú)線傳感器節(jié)點(diǎn)所涉及的理論基礎(chǔ)、軟件、硬件設(shè)計(jì)原理和實(shí)現(xiàn)方法以及應(yīng)用無(wú)線傳感器網(wǎng)絡(luò)的實(shí)際工程案例。附錄中給出了作者自行開(kāi)發(fā)的微代碼的操作系統(tǒng)——PIC18系列微處理網(wǎng)絡(luò)版操作系統(tǒng)。在本書(shū)配套的光盤(pán)中給出了作者自主開(kāi)發(fā)的實(shí)時(shí)操作系統(tǒng)和應(yīng)用操作系統(tǒng)的12個(gè)實(shí)例代碼,以幫助讀者更好地開(kāi)發(fā)自己的無(wú)線傳感器網(wǎng)絡(luò)產(chǎn)品和工程應(yīng)用。 本書(shū)主要適合從事無(wú)線傳感器網(wǎng)絡(luò)領(lǐng)域工作,特別是產(chǎn)品開(kāi)發(fā)和工程應(yīng)用的讀者,也可作為計(jì)算機(jī)、電子、自動(dòng)化和通信等專(zhuān)業(yè)的本科生和研究生的教材。
書(shū)籍目錄
前言 第1章 緒論 1.1 引言 1.2 傳感器技術(shù)的發(fā)展 1.2.1 微型化 1.2.2 智能化 1.2.3 多功能傳感器 1.3 無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用 1.3.1 軍事領(lǐng)域 1.3.2 環(huán)境監(jiān)測(cè) 1.3.3 醫(yī)療健康監(jiān)測(cè) 1.3.4 建筑物監(jiān)測(cè)及城市管理 1.3.5 智能交通 1.3.6 藥品管理和衛(wèi)生保健 1.4 無(wú)線傳感器網(wǎng)絡(luò)研究熱點(diǎn)問(wèn)題和關(guān)鍵技術(shù) 1.5 幾種無(wú)線網(wǎng)絡(luò) 1.6 關(guān)于無(wú)線傳感器網(wǎng)絡(luò)的開(kāi)發(fā) 第2章 IEEE 802.15.4協(xié)議 2.1 IEEE 802.15.4的主要特點(diǎn) 2.2 IEEE 802.15.4的物理層 2.2.1 物理層服務(wù)規(guī)范 2.2.2 物理層協(xié)議數(shù)據(jù)單元格式 2.3 IEEE 802.15.4的MAC層 2.3.1 MAC幀的結(jié)構(gòu) 2.3.2 MAC幀的分類(lèi) 2.4 MAC層完成的基本服務(wù) 2.4.1 MAC層數(shù)據(jù)服務(wù) 2.4.2 MAC層管理服務(wù) 第3章 ZigBee協(xié)議介紹 3.1 概述 3.2 應(yīng)用層規(guī)范 3.2.1 ZigBee應(yīng)用支持子層 3.2.2 應(yīng)用支持子層的管理實(shí)體 3.2.3 APS數(shù)據(jù)服務(wù) 3.2.4 APS管理服務(wù) 3.2.5 APS的帖格式 3.2.6 特殊幀類(lèi)型格式 3.3 APS常數(shù)和PIB屬性 3.3.1 APS常數(shù) 3.3.2 APS信息數(shù)據(jù)庫(kù) 3.4 網(wǎng)絡(luò)層 3.4.1 網(wǎng)絡(luò)層幀格式 3.4.2 網(wǎng)絡(luò)層常量和NIB屬性 3.5 ZigBee的網(wǎng)絡(luò)建立過(guò)程 第4章 WSN定位與信息處理 4.1 節(jié)點(diǎn)定位技術(shù) 4.1.1 概述 4.1.2 定位算法的分類(lèi) 4.1.3 測(cè)距方法的分類(lèi) 4.2 計(jì)算節(jié)點(diǎn)位置的算法 4.3 IEEE 802.15.4的定位思路 4.4 網(wǎng)絡(luò)控制系統(tǒng)的控制方法 4.4.1 變時(shí)滯網(wǎng)絡(luò)控制系統(tǒng) 4.4.2 數(shù)據(jù)丟失網(wǎng)絡(luò)控制系統(tǒng) 4.4.3 帶寬有限網(wǎng)絡(luò)控制系統(tǒng) 4.5 無(wú)線傳感器網(wǎng)絡(luò)信號(hào)估計(jì) 4.5.1 不可靠網(wǎng)絡(luò)中的估計(jì)問(wèn)題 4.5.2 信息丟失系統(tǒng) 4.5.3 基于量化數(shù)據(jù)的估計(jì)問(wèn)題 第5章 無(wú)線傳感器網(wǎng)絡(luò)系統(tǒng)應(yīng)用軟件 5.1 無(wú)線傳感器網(wǎng)絡(luò)的操作系統(tǒng) 5.2 自主知識(shí)產(chǎn)權(quán)的WSN操作系統(tǒng)wsnRTOS 5.2.1 操作系統(tǒng)結(jié)構(gòu)設(shè)計(jì)簡(jiǎn)介 5.2.2 操作系統(tǒng)的特點(diǎn) 5.3 射頻通信與控制軟件 5.3.1 SPI通信設(shè)計(jì) 5.3.2 CC2500的控制軟件功能 5.4 網(wǎng)關(guān)軟件的設(shè)計(jì) 第6章 無(wú)線傳感器網(wǎng)絡(luò)的無(wú)線傳輸理論基礎(chǔ)第7章 無(wú)線傳感器網(wǎng)絡(luò)硬件第8章 無(wú)線傳感器網(wǎng)絡(luò)在油井監(jiān)測(cè)系統(tǒng)中的應(yīng)用第9章 無(wú)線傳感器網(wǎng)絡(luò)系統(tǒng)在路燈節(jié)能中的應(yīng)用 第10章 無(wú)線傳感器網(wǎng)絡(luò)其他應(yīng)用舉例附錄 PIC18系列微處理器網(wǎng)絡(luò)版操作系統(tǒng)參考文獻(xiàn)
章節(jié)摘錄
3.傳感器集成化 傳感器是無(wú)線傳感器網(wǎng)絡(luò)存在的基礎(chǔ),但是傳統(tǒng)傳感器一般體積和功耗都較大,顯然將傳統(tǒng)的傳感器與射頻器件直接組合構(gòu)成無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n),不符合無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)的特點(diǎn)。因此如何在無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)上設(shè)計(jì)小型化和低功耗的傳感器是無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)設(shè)計(jì)的另一個(gè)需要突破的技術(shù)難關(guān)?! ∧壳翱梢耘c節(jié)點(diǎn)集成到一起的傳感器有:溫度傳感器、濕度傳感器、照度傳感器等少量傳感器。大量的傳感器還未能與無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)集成在一起,未來(lái)解決這個(gè)問(wèn)題可能主要依靠MEMS技術(shù)?! ?.電源多樣化 無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)最基本的供電方式是電池,但是為了提高無(wú)線傳感器網(wǎng)絡(luò)節(jié)點(diǎn)的壽命,新的能量供給方式也是必須要考慮的。現(xiàn)在能夠投入實(shí)用的供電方式主要有太陽(yáng)能、風(fēng)能和振動(dòng)發(fā)電。當(dāng)供電技術(shù)解決后,無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用將會(huì)取得一個(gè)更大的進(jìn)步。需要指出的是,即使是供電電源也要按照小型化原則進(jìn)行設(shè)計(jì)?! ?.軟件簡(jiǎn)單化 無(wú)線傳感器網(wǎng)絡(luò)的節(jié)點(diǎn)若滿足體積、功耗的要求,軟件的設(shè)計(jì)最好越小越好,這樣就可以占據(jù)更少的資源??墒沁@又存在一個(gè)矛盾的問(wèn)題,從自組網(wǎng)要求來(lái)講,需要軟件十分的穩(wěn)定,能夠在多種復(fù)雜條件下實(shí)現(xiàn)網(wǎng)絡(luò)的可靠組建與傳輸。要滿足這個(gè)要求,軟件協(xié)議棧就要比較完善,程序代碼的量就大,需要的硬件資源就多。如果只強(qiáng)調(diào)軟件功能的完善,就不可避免的造成資源需求的擴(kuò)大化,比如現(xiàn)在有些節(jié)點(diǎn)甚至采用ARM7或.ARM9來(lái)實(shí)現(xiàn)的。 雖然存在這個(gè)矛盾,但從實(shí)際應(yīng)用的角度看,一旦無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用目標(biāo)確定下來(lái),軟件的功能設(shè)置也就確定了,根據(jù)實(shí)際應(yīng)用可以對(duì)軟件功能進(jìn)行精簡(jiǎn)?! ?.功能單一化 雖然從理論的角度看節(jié)點(diǎn)的功能越多越好,但是就實(shí)際的應(yīng)用來(lái)看,無(wú)線傳感器網(wǎng)絡(luò)的節(jié)點(diǎn)功能并不是越多越好,必須在節(jié)點(diǎn)功能和節(jié)點(diǎn)資源之間進(jìn)行平衡,從無(wú)線傳感器網(wǎng)絡(luò)實(shí)際應(yīng)用看,無(wú)線傳感器網(wǎng)絡(luò)的應(yīng)用對(duì)象一般都非常明確,過(guò)多的功能意義不大。比如當(dāng)前許多商用的無(wú)線傳感器網(wǎng)絡(luò)的DEMO板,這些DEMO板作為實(shí)驗(yàn)室中的調(diào)試工具是很有意義的,但若直接用到某個(gè)具體應(yīng)用,則就有些浪費(fèi)了。應(yīng)將其硬件結(jié)構(gòu)進(jìn)行簡(jiǎn)化設(shè)計(jì),只要能達(dá)到要求,其他功能應(yīng)盡量簡(jiǎn)化。 7.2接地設(shè)計(jì) 接地設(shè)計(jì)無(wú)論在何種電路設(shè)計(jì)中不管如何強(qiáng)調(diào)都不過(guò)分,在無(wú)線傳感器網(wǎng)絡(luò)中,接地主要討論射頻接地的問(wèn)題。
圖書(shū)封面
評(píng)論、評(píng)分、閱讀與下載
無(wú)線傳感器網(wǎng)絡(luò)技術(shù)與工程應(yīng)用 PDF格式下載
250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版